South Carolina vs. Missouri game 3 recap: Gamecocks blow out Tigers 13-4, win series

South Carolina’s offense stayed hot on Sunday, as the Gamecocks scored double digit runs for the second game in a row to clinch the series against Missouri.

The Tigers took an early lead, going up 1-0 in the first on a leadoff home run from Mark Vierling. USC answered in the bottom of the inning though, taking a 2-1 lead after Brady Allen knocked a base hit to start things off, Wes Clarke walked with two outs, and David Mendham brought them both home with a single. The Cocks added two more runs in the next inning, as Colin Burgess led off with a double and Brennan Milone followed with a dinger, making it 4-1.
